Seelampur murder: Who is Zikra, the 'lady don' arrested for stabbing of teen?

Zikra, aka 'lady don'

A woman was arrested and three others detained in connection with the fatal stabbing of a teenager in northeast Delhi's Seelampur area.

 

Kunal Singh, 17, was stabbed near his house at around 7.30pm on Thursday. He was rushed to the JPC Hospital nearby but doctors declared him brought dead. The killing sparked off protests in the area, with several Hindu outfits demanding immediate arrest of the culprits.

 

"Ten teams have been formed to crack the case, and they are looking at all possible angles,” Joint Commissioner of Police (Eastern Range), Pushpendra Kumar, told PTI. “We have detained a few people for questioning. The case will be solved soon.”

 

Who is Zikra?

 

The woman arrested has been identified as Zikra, known locally as ‘lady don’. She worked as a bouncer for jailed gangster Hashim Baba's wife, Zoya, who was arrested by Delhi Police in a drugs case.

 

Reports suggest that Zikra was trying to form her own gang after the arrest of Zoya, with who she used to live.

 

"Zikra had ambitions to launch her own gang. She wanted to get close to Hashim Baba through Zoya and also wanted to get involved in her drugs business. However, her plans suffered a setback after the arrest of Zoya, who helped her procure arms and ammunition," PTI quoted a source as saying.

 

Zikra is notorious for her videos on social media where she is seen brandishing firearms. She was arrested earlier under the Arms Act. Out on bail, she had rented a house near Kunal Singh's place. 

 

Kunal Singh's murder an act of revenge?

 

Kunal’s family claimed that Zikra was present when he was fatally stabbed.

 

PTI quoted police officers as saying that Zikra wanted to avenge her brother’s stabbing. Since coming out of jail around 15 days before the Seelampur murder, she was on the lookout for a person named ‘Lala’ who had allegedly beaten her brother, Hindustan Times reported. She had reportedly asked Kunal about Lala, and had got him stabbed when he could not help her.

 

Reports also suggest that the gang believed Kunal was part of the group that attacked Sahil. Kunal’s family says his murder could be an act of revenge by Zikra’s gang.

 

Security has been beefed up in the area with the deployment of police and Rapid Action Force.
